24小(xiǎo)时联系電(diàn)话:18217114652、13661815404
中文(wén)
- 您当前的位置:
- 首页>
- 電(diàn)子资讯>
- 行业资讯>
- MCU内部振荡器的优缺...
行业资讯
MCU内部振荡器的优缺点
低成本微控制器单元通常带有(yǒu)内部RC振荡器,而不是外部陶瓷或石英晶體(tǐ)振荡器。但是,您应该对此振荡器进行微调。
您最喜欢的MCU可(kě)能(néng)有(yǒu)一个内部RC振荡器。来自所有(yǒu)主要制造商(shāng)的众多(duō)微控制器系列都包含此模块,包括德州仪器(TI),意法半导體(tǐ)(STMicroelectronics)和Microchip的产品。几乎所有(yǒu)制造商(shāng)都在線(xiàn)提供了随附的应用(yòng)筆(bǐ)记,内容涉及如何校准其MCU的内部振荡器。
使用(yòng)内部振荡器有(yǒu)很(hěn)多(duō)好处,您可(kě)能(néng)并不需要外部晶體(tǐ)或陶瓷振荡器。但是,有(yǒu)些关键应用(yòng)需要非常精确的时序,例如串行端口,计时器和USB接口。即使对于大多(duō)数这些应用(yòng),如果您对其进行微调,则内部振荡器也可(kě)能(néng)符合严格的时序要求。
继续阅读以了解内部振荡器和简单的校准程序,以获取时钟信号的最佳性能(néng)。
内部振荡器的好处
内部振荡器无处不在是有(yǒu)原因的。这里有(yǒu)一些好处:
1.它们需要较少的外部组件。不再需要外部振荡器電(diàn)路或其反馈電(diàn)路。这会对预算,PCB面积以及成品小(xiǎo)工具的整體(tǐ)尺寸产生积极影响。
2.他(tā)们保留了一个或两个可(kě)用(yòng)于I / O的引脚。 大多(duō)数引脚数较少的MCU会為(wèi)每个引脚分(fēn)配多(duō)个功能(néng),以供用(yòng)户选择其用(yòng)途。因此,如果您选择在MCU中使用(yòng)内部振荡器,则会释放时钟输入引脚,或者释放晶體(tǐ)或陶瓷谐振器所在的两个引脚。
3.它们将高频保持在IC内部。 尽管某些微控制器在100kHz以下的低频下使用(yòng)晶體(tǐ)或陶瓷谐振器,但使用(yòng)10MHz或以上的外部振荡器更為(wèi)常见。这种高时钟频率几乎总是由CPU专用(yòng),并在MCU内部為(wèi)其外围模块(ADC,UART,SPI,USB,GPIO等)进行了预缩放。
在某些PCB中,芯片外具有(yǒu)高频可(kě)能(néng)是一个问题,因此将高频保持在内部通常是一个好主意。
内部振荡器的缺点
内部振荡器由集成電(diàn)路内部的電(diàn)阻器和電(diàn)容器组成。在芯片内部生产这些无源器件有(yǒu)其局限性,特别是在准确性和可(kě)重复性方面。这意味着两个相同的微控制器芯片可(kě)能(néng)会在其内部振荡器频率上显示出有(yǒu)意义的差异,就像两个相同的吉他(tā)在两个不同的晚宴上进行调音后将以略微不同的音调弹奏一样。
除了获得芯片内部的電(diàn)阻和電(diàn)容的预期值(精度),并且為(wèi)所有(yǒu)芯片获得完全相同的值(重复性)之外,还有(yǒu)温度问题。事实证明,電(diàn)容和電(diàn)阻均会随温度发生轻微变化,这对于内部振荡器尤其重要。因此,您不仅 不必担心不同芯片以稍微不同的频率工作,而且还不必担心它们的频率会随温度而变化。
如果您不希望环境温度发生剧烈变化,则在校准内部振荡器后就不必担心。但是,如果您预计温度会发生很(hěn)大变化,并且系统对频率变化高度敏感(例如实时时钟或高速通信系统),那么最好使用(yòng)外部振荡器。